Black Polka: Adding a Playful Touch to Your Creative Projects

A Typeface That Doesn't Take Itself Too Seriously

Finding a font that balances personality with professionalism can be a real challenge. You want something that stands out, something with character, but it can't compromise the clarity of your message. This is where Black Polka enters the conversation. It’s a color font, specifically an OpenType-SVG typeface, which means the polka dot pattern you see is baked directly into the font file itself. Each letter is rendered with its own unique, adorable dotted design, creating a visual texture that a standard font simply can't replicate.

The visual appeal of Black Polka is immediate. It’s playful, whimsical, and has a distinctly charming aesthetic. Imagine the classic simplicity of a sans serif foundation, but infused with a sense of fun and lightheartedness. The personality of this font is approachable and friendly. It doesn't feel sterile or overly corporate. Instead, it evokes feelings of joy, creativity, and a certain handmade quality that resonates deeply in today's design landscape. For anyone looking to inject a bit of personality into their work, Black Polka offers a compelling solution that feels both modern and timeless in its appeal.

Where Black Polka Truly Shines

So, where does a creative font like this actually work? The applications are surprisingly broad, especially for projects targeting an audience that appreciates a personal, crafted touch. Think about branding for a boutique bakery, a children's clothing line, or a stationery brand. A logo design incorporating Black Polka would instantly communicate a sense of fun and care. It sets a brand identity that is memorable and feels less corporate, more community-focused. This typeface isn't just for logos, though. It’s fantastic for editorial design, like the headers in a lifestyle magazine or a blog post title that needs to grab attention without shouting.

The utility extends far beyond print. In the realm of digital design, Black Polka is a powerhouse for social media graphics. An Instagram quote, a Facebook event announcement, or a Pinterest pin using this font will naturally stand out in a crowded feed. Its visual texture makes it perfect for web design elements like call-to-action buttons or featured article titles, where you want to guide the user's eye effectively. For packaging design, imagine the word "Chocolate" or "Vanilla" on a gift box rendered in this dotted typeface—it adds an instant layer of delight and perceived value. Crafters and hobbyists will also find it invaluable for personal projects like custom invitations, scrapbooking, or DIY craft designs using compatible software like Silhouette.

Practical Guidance for Using a Display Font

While Black Polka is versatile, it’s important to understand its strengths. As a display font, its primary role is to attract attention. This makes it perfect for headlines, subheadings, logos, and short bursts of text. You wouldn’t use it for the body copy of a lengthy report; its charming details would become distracting and hinder readability at small sizes. The key to effective use is understanding visual hierarchy. Let Black Polka do the heavy lifting for your primary message, and pair it with a clean, simple serif font or sans serif font for supporting text. This contrast creates a balanced and professional layout.

Before you commit to a project, it’s wise to test font pairings. Try setting a headline in Black Polka and see how it looks next to a classic serif font like Garamond or a modern sans serif like Helvetica. The goal is to find a partner that complements without competing. Because Black Polka is a premium font with a distinct style, consistency is key to building strong brand recognition. Using it consistently across your marketing materials will help solidify your brand identity.

A crucial technical note: this is an OpenType-SVG color font. It is compatible with professional design software like Adobe Photoshop, Illustrator, and open-source alternatives like Inkscape. However, it is not compatible with Cricut design software. Always check the included file formats (OTF and/or TTF) and review the licensing for your intended use, whether personal or commercial.
